About YAKUB

YAKUB is a cryptocurrency designed to facilitate seamless peer-to-peer transactions while promoting community-driven initiatives. It utilizes a proof-of-stake consensus mechanism, which enhances energy efficiency and transaction speed. The primary target audience for YAKUB includes individuals interested in decentralized finance solutions and community engagement projects. Traders and investors track this coin due to its potential for fostering innovative financial applications and its commitment to building a supportive ecosystem for users.
